The Special City Council meeting held on April 21, 2025, focused on the implications of federal budget priorities and staffing changes. Council members expressed concerns about the ongoing trend of cost-cutting measures at the federal level, particularly regarding staffing reductions.
During the discussion, a council member inquired about the administration's operational priorities and how these would be reflected in the upcoming federal budget. The response highlighted that the budget serves as a critical document outlining the priorities for each administration and the funding needs of various agencies. It was noted that a full budget is expected to be released within the next month, which will clarify these priorities.
Additionally, there was mention of a "skinny budget," which would provide a high-level overview rather than detailed allocations. This approach may limit the information available to the council regarding specific funding and operational priorities.
The conversation also touched on the patterns of layoffs within federal agencies, suggesting that the areas experiencing the most significant staffing reductions could indicate where the administration's priorities lie. The council emphasized the importance of understanding both what is included in the budget and what is not, as this will impact local governance and planning.
In conclusion, the council is awaiting further details from the federal budget to better understand the implications for local operations and staffing, highlighting the interconnectedness of federal decisions and local governance.
